没问题 (méiwèntí) No Problem (Beginner)

The character “没 (méi)” means no or not; “问题 (wèntí)” means problem.

Example:

A: Dǎrǎo yíxià, qǐngwèn néng gěi wǒ jiǎng yíxià zhèdào tímù ma?
    打扰    一下,请问      能     给   我 讲     一下 这道    题目 吗?

Excuse me; can you help me out with this question?

B: Méiwèntí
    没问题。

No problem.
